Just one thing
2017, the new year has started. Maybe you've got some new year resolutions and maybe you've already read a blog post or two about someone else's plans for 2017.
How about instead, we try to change just one thing. Anything, but just one. Not more.
I find it useful to remind myself that networks like Twitter, Facebook, Instagram, Medium and so on are social media networks. Social media. I'd never compare my day to day life to the media I see represented in the news or TV, and yet it seems like the lives I see in social media are somehow something I should relate to.
Social media is somehow not a network for communication but a network to represent ones own brand image. Communication obviously still happens, but I see a tonne of pressure from the web dev industry upon itself to be better, faster, stronger. This message is constantly reinforced by "10 ES6 features every developer should learn" and "5 framework feature you didn't know about" and so on.
There's only a constant barage of smart content from people who are smarter than me and you, but also a non-stop flow of things I should know.
So here's my suggestion:
Do one thing. And you don't even need to do it well. Heck, don't do one thing, and just carry on keeping your head above water.
